The Best of Them All
Every Tuesday, an 11-round online blitz Swiss is conducted on the famous chess website, chesscom, which is open to all the titled chess player – Titled Tuesday.
Post pandemic, the tournament has grown more popular and is now even conducted twice every Tuesday (Early and Late editions), offering attractive prizes for the top finishers, considering players can take-part from the comfort of their homes. Consequently, some of world’s best blitz players including like Magnus, Firouzja, Duda, MVL, Nepomniachtchi contest frequently.
World No. 3 Hikaru Nakamura is a regular visitor to the event. He plays and streams his games on platforms like Twitch and Kick almost every Tuesday. Hikaru is known to be one of the highest-rated blitz players on the website, getting contests only from the likes of Carlsen, Firouzja, or Nihal Sarin, who are regulars on the top 3 leaderboard.
Hikaru has won the Titled Tuesday on numerous occasions, but is also the only player to have clinched a DOUBLE multiple times!
Last Tuesday, Nov 12, Hikaru swept the Early and the Late Titled Tuesday by scoring 10/11 in both!
Only five other players have achieved this feat: Magnus Carlsen, Alireza Firouzja, Wesley So, MVL, and José Martinez. But the most impressive part is that none of these players have scored a Double more than once, while this was Nakamura’s EIGHTH Double!
